Best Practices for Incident Response and Digital Forensics

Adhering to best practices is vital for ensuring that incident response and digital forensics efforts are effective and efficient. Here are some key best practices covered in the Advanced Certificate program:

1. Proactive Monitoring: Continuous monitoring of network traffic and system logs can help detect anomalies early. Implementing proactive monitoring tools and techniques is a cornerstone of effective incident response.

2. Isolate and Contain: Once a threat is detected, it's crucial to isolate the affected systems to prevent the spread of malware or unauthorized access. Containment strategies should be flexible and adaptable to different types of incidents.

3. Preserve Evidence: Digital evidence can be easily altered or destroyed. Best practices include creating forensic images of affected systems and using write-blockers to prevent accidental data modification.

4. Collaborate and Communicate: Effective incident response requires collaboration across various teams and departments. Clear communication channels and protocols ensure that all stakeholders are informed and aligned.

5. Continuous Improvement: Incident response and digital forensics are dynamic fields. Regularly updating incident response plans and forensic techniques based on emerging threats and technologies is essential for staying ahead.
